How to Enhance Your Sexual Relationship

Couple in lingerie with man removing woman's bra, with tips for enhancing your sexual relationship.

A healthy and fulfilling sexual relationship is an important part of any romantic partnership. But sometimes, even the most passionate couples can experience a lull in their sex lives. If you’re looking to enhance your sexual relationship, here are some tips to help you get started:

Communicate Openly and Honestly

According to a study by Lybrate, sexual communication is an essential component of a satisfying sex life. It allows couples to share their desires and needs with each other, leading to greater intimacy and sexual pleasure. Communication is key in any relationship, but especially when it comes to sex. Many couples feel awkward talking about their sexual desires and needs, but open communication is essential for a healthy sexual relationship. Talk openly and honestly with your partner about your desires, fantasies, and boundaries. Make sure to listen to your partner and be respectful of their desires and boundaries as well. This can help you both feel more comfortable and confident in the bedroom, and can lead to more fulfilling sexual experiences.

Try Something New

If you’re feeling stuck in a sexual rut, trying something new can be a great way to reignite the passion. This could mean experimenting with new positions, introducing sex toys such as vibrators, dildos, or bondage gear to spice things up in the bedroom. You can even try a different type of sexual activity altogether. Trying new things can help you and your partner explore different sides of your sexuality and can bring a sense of novelty and excitement to your sex life.

Focus on Foreplay

Foreplay can be just as important as the main event when it comes to enhancing your sexual relationship. Many people rush through foreplay, but taking your time can lead to more intense and pleasurable sexual experiences. Spend time exploring each other’s bodies, kissing, touching, and teasing. This can help build anticipation and make the sex itself more satisfying. Don’t be afraid to mix things up and try different types of foreplay, such as massage, oral sex, or sensual touching.

Practice Self-Care

Taking care of your own physical and mental health can also have a positive impact on your sexual relationship. When you feel good about yourself, you’re more likely to feel confident and sexy in the bedroom. Exercise regularly, eat a healthy diet, and take time to relax and de-stress. This can help boost your energy and libido, and can lead to more satisfying sexual experiences with your partner.

Make Time for Intimacy

In our busy lives, it can be easy to let sex fall by the wayside. But making time for intimacy is essential for a healthy sexual relationship. Whether it’s scheduling a regular date night or simply making an effort to prioritize physical touch and connection, carving out time for sex can help keep your relationship strong and fulfilling. Try to create an atmosphere of intimacy and relaxation when you’re together. This can help you and your partner feel more connected and can lead to more satisfying sexual experiences.

Remember, every relationship is unique, and what works for one couple may not work for another. But by focusing on communication, trying new things, and prioritizing intimacy, you can enhance your sexual relationship and enjoy a more fulfilling and satisfying sex life. By taking the time to explore your sexuality and communicate with your partner, you can build a stronger, more intimate bond that will enhance all aspects of your relationship.
